Where is the Berri Riverside Holiday Park?

In the Riverland town of Berri, the Berri Riverside Holiday Park (to give the official name) is in a prime position on the north bank of the river. It’s a family-friendly place to stay, and offers a range of accommodation from tent sites to three bedroom poolside cabins.

Berri caravan park facilities

Aside from the location, the key selling point of the Berri Caravan Park is the facilities. There are camp kitchens and barbecues dotted throughout the park and a pool that’s large by Australian caravan park standards.

For kids, there are two jumping pillows, a playground and a giant chess set. Active types, meanwhile, will enjoy the basketball court, BMX track and hireable pedal carts.

Berri caravan park rates

Rates at the Berri caravan park are fairly reasonable. The Berri Riverside Holiday Park charges from $120 a night for cabins that sleep up to six people. These cabins come with full kitchens, TVs and air-conditioning.

Bookings should be made online in advance, as cabins can sell out during peak periods.

Alternative places to stay in Berri include the Big River Golf and Country Club and the Berri Hotel.

The drive from Adelaide to Berri is 243km long, and takes around two hours and 40 minutes.
